China fujian fuzhou Says ha tae-keung telecom
Websites on 110.83.40.144
- Domain names that have been bound:
- 2020-10-10-----2020-10-16aipc.tpddns.cn
- website server lookup history
- xp225.com
- vv9586.com
- gg3918.com
- xp413.com
- 83568x.com
- vv9299.com
- 667xp.com
- 568xp.com
- 373xp.com
- xh5595.com
- hd15388.com
- 142977.com
- 5672008.com
- 9589555.com
- jsss63.com
- apiproxy.iflix.com
- 909395.com
- 3405hhh.com
- 58155q.com
- yongli27.com
- hosting ip address lookup history
- 72.246.220.186
- 223.119.243.60
- 184.28.252.211
- 18.162.147.203
- 121.201.42.126
- 123.59.184.197
- 43.230.114.208
- 43.230.114.215
- 192.151.230.64
- 192.151.230.78
- 18.139.189.211
- 119.8.46.167
- 149.56.201.241
- 54.251.147.179
- 54.151.247.165
- 123.129.241.67
- 13.213.243.219
- 38.165.119.224
- 101.36.125.103
- 104.26.15.196